Transaction 6151391524d6b396d81bc4daf52d447e743a63ecf2c47185ea901b0869ed2486

1 Input
2 Outputs
  • 6151391524d6b396d81bc4daf52d447e743a63ecf2c47185ea901b0869ed2486:0
  • value  6051770
    address  34gUGVfF4BFDn7SD2rBdaRxpjuvbB385Vi
  • 6151391524d6b396d81bc4daf52d447e743a63ecf2c47185ea901b0869ed2486:1
  • value  51560
    address  1P17mUsERvFQ4KvuaU6xgpEqf2FErb3pjZ